Villa Carmignac Fondation d'art contemporain

Located in Porquerolles, in the heart of a national park, the Villa Carmignac welcomes the public every year to discover contemporary art exhibitions, a sculpture garden and a cultural program.
It is in Porquerolles, a Mediterranean forest in the open sea, that the Foundation created in 2000 on the initiative of Édouard Carmignac, meets the public.
In the middle of an exceptional national park, visitors will discover contemporary works of art from the Carmignac collection, temporary exhibitions, a sculpture garden and a cultural program.

The island is not a trivial choice: "As in any myth or initiatory journey, the crossing to the island is always a double movement, one physical, the other mental. It is about passing to the other shore." in the words of its Director, Charles Carmignac.

Arriving on the island, the visitor will discover a Provencal farmhouse, blending into the landscape. Inside, the volumes expand and reveal 2000 m2 of exhibition rooms. Natural light, filtered by an aquatic ceiling, illuminates the spaces hidden beneath the surface.
Outside, a 15-hectare garden designed by landscaper Louis Benech is inhabited by a series of works inspired by the place.

Physical disability

The 2000m² of exhibition space inside are accessible to people with reduced mobility (lifts). For people with a reduced mobility card (the card will be checked) who can get out of their wheelchair to get into the car and whose wheelchair folds, the villa can offer free car pick-up from the port upon reservation. Please note that this service is not guaranteed (subject to availability). Otherwise, people with reduced mobility can use the luggage taxi. For the visit to the garden, the Villa kindly lends an "all-terrain" wheelchair.
